Adriano considered suicide: mother

ROME (AFP) - The mother of AS Roma forward Adriano has claimed her son wanted to commit suicide during the depths of his depression.

Adriano walked out of Italy a year and a half ago when an Inter Milan player, citing depression as his reason for wanting to return home to Brazil.

But after a season at Flamengo in his home city of Rio de Janeiro, the 28-year-old has come back to Italy with Roma.

And although he has visibly piled on the pounds even since his most lax days in Milan, his mother Dona Rosilda believes his new club can help him complete his recovery.

"The source of his depression has always been the death of his father which he has never overcome," she told Thursday's Gazzetta dello Sport.
